黑狐家游戏

对象存储和数据块存储空间,对象存储和数据库的区别在哪里,深入解析,对象存储与数据块存储的差异与优劣

欧气 0 0
对象存储与数据块存储在架构和用途上存在显著差异。对象存储以对象为单位存储数据,支持海量小文件,适用于非结构化数据;而数据块存储按块存储数据,适合大型文件存储。对象存储优势在于高效访问和灵活性,劣势是性能相对较低。数据块存储性能较高,但扩展性较差。两者根据具体应用场景选择,以达到最佳存储效果。

本文目录导读:

  1. 对象存储与数据块存储的定义
  2. 对象存储与数据块存储的特点
  3. 对象存储与数据块存储的应用场景

随着大数据时代的到来,数据存储的需求日益增长,对象存储和数据块存储作为两种常见的存储方式,广泛应用于云计算、大数据等领域,本文将从对象存储和数据块存储的定义、特点、应用场景等方面进行分析,帮助读者更好地了解它们之间的差异。

对象存储和数据块存储空间,对象存储和数据库的区别在哪里,深入解析,对象存储与数据块存储的差异与优劣

图片来源于网络,如有侵权联系删除

对象存储与数据块存储的定义

1、对象存储

对象存储是一种基于文件的存储方式,以对象为单位进行存储,每个对象由数据、元数据和唯一标识符(ID)组成,对象存储系统通常采用分布式架构,具有高可靠性、可扩展性和灵活性等特点。

2、数据块存储

数据块存储是一种基于块的存储方式,将数据分割成多个小块进行存储,每个数据块由唯一的标识符和对应的存储位置组成,数据块存储系统通常采用集中式架构,具有高性能、高吞吐量等特点。

对象存储与数据块存储的特点

1、对象存储特点

(1)高可靠性:采用分布式架构,数据冗余存储,降低数据丢失风险。

(2)可扩展性:支持海量数据存储,满足大规模应用需求。

(3)灵活性:支持多种数据类型存储,如图片、视频、文档等。

对象存储和数据块存储空间,对象存储和数据库的区别在哪里,深入解析,对象存储与数据块存储的差异与优劣

图片来源于网络,如有侵权联系删除

(4)安全性:采用访问控制、加密等技术,保障数据安全。

2、数据块存储特点

(1)高性能:采用集中式架构,读写速度快,满足高性能需求。

(2)高吞吐量:支持大量并发读写操作,满足大数据场景需求。

(3)易于管理:数据块存储系统通常具有丰富的管理功能,便于维护。

(4)兼容性强:支持多种协议和接口,方便与其他系统对接。

对象存储与数据块存储的应用场景

1、对象存储应用场景

(1)云存储:为用户提供云存储服务,如图片、视频、文档等。

对象存储和数据块存储空间,对象存储和数据库的区别在哪里,深入解析,对象存储与数据块存储的差异与优劣

图片来源于网络,如有侵权联系删除

(2)大数据分析:存储海量数据,支持大数据分析。

(3)CDN加速:缓存热点数据,提高访问速度。

2、数据块存储应用场景

(1)高性能计算:为高性能计算提供数据存储支持。

(2)数据库存储:为数据库提供数据存储服务。

(3)分布式存储:为分布式系统提供数据存储支持。

对象存储与数据块存储作为两种常见的存储方式,在特点和适用场景上存在一定差异,在实际应用中,应根据具体需求选择合适的存储方式,对象存储在可靠性、可扩展性和灵活性方面具有优势,适用于云存储、大数据分析等领域;数据块存储在性能和吞吐量方面具有优势,适用于高性能计算、数据库存储等领域,了解两者之间的差异,有助于我们更好地选择合适的存储方案,满足不同场景的需求。

标签: #对象存储特性 #存储方式对比 #存储差异分析

黑狐家游戏
  • 评论列表

留言评论